FHA Loan Max Loan amount for Dermott, Chicot County, AR in 2025

In 2025, the FHA loan limit for Dermott county in Chicot, AR is $472,030 for a single-family home. It increases to $604,400 for 2-unit properties, $730,525 for 3-units, and $907,900 for 4-unit residences.

Maximum amounts for conventional loans are $726,200 for a single-family home, $929,850 for 2-unit structures, $1,123,900 for 3-units, and $1,396,800 for 4-units.
